Phil Gregory’s “Footprint” tells the story of a fleeting holiday romance – two people swept up in the joy of the moment, but holding very different perspectives. For one, the connection blossoms into something deeper, a love they hope will last. For the other, it remains just a sun-soaked memory, destined to fade.
The track captures that bittersweet space between hope and loss, all told with Phil Gregory’s trademark warmth and honesty.

Phil Gregory’s upcoming EP (release date still to be announced) will feature six songs exploring the many sides of relationships. From the raw intensity of lust in “Number on My Mind” to the heartbreak and healing of a broken marriage in “Heart & Soul,” the project promises an emotional journey through love in all its forms.

More info about Phil Gregory
Born in southern England in the 1950s and now splitting his time between the UK and South Africa, Gregory’s sound blends country, rock, and pop. This unique mix defines his fresh yet timeless approach to contemporary country music.
Phil Gregory introduced his voice to a wider audience with his debut album Good Intentions (2020), which included the single “Names” – a track that broke into the Top 100 on Mix FM South Africa.
He followed with the EP 22: Not Out (2022), featuring “Movin’ On,” which landed spots on Apple Music South Africa’s New Music Daily and New Singer-Songwriter playlists. Other standouts included “Nowhere For Our Love To Hide” and “Holding Candles.”
In 2024, Phil Gregory revisited his roots with the nostalgic EP Botley Drive, inspired by his childhood home in Leigh Park, Portsmouth. Songs such as “If I Can’t Have You” and “Key To Your Heart” enjoyed wide radio play across South Africa.
Phil Gregory’s music bridges memory and melody, weaving the nostalgia of his British upbringing with the vibrant contemporary sounds of South African country pop. His ongoing collaboration with nephew Billy Gregory of UK band Crystal Tides brings a modern edge to his classic storytelling.
With “Footprint,” Phil Gregory once again shows his ability to capture life’s fleeting moments – reminding us that even short-lived connections can leave the deepest marks.
